Why Choose Composite Doors?

Composite doors stand apart amongst standard wood or metal doors for several compelling factors. Here are a number of essential benefits:

  1. Durability:Composite doors are built to endure extreme we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and strong winds. Unlike wooden doors, they do not warp, swell, or crack gradually.

  2. Security:These doors are normally constructed with multi-point locking systems, making them much more hard to break into compared to basic doors. The robust products utilized in their construction include an additional layer of security.

  3. Energy Efficiency:With their insulated core, composite doors stand out in keeping heat within your home. This energy performance can result in lower heating bills, making them an economically sound option in the long run.

  4. Low Maintenance:Unlike conventional wooden doors that need routine painting or staining, composite doors are simple to tidy and usually need very little maintenance. Simply wipe down the surface with a damp cloth to keep them looking new.

  5. Aesthetic Appeal:Composite doors come in a variety of designs, colors, and surfaces. They can be made to replicate the appearance of traditional wood doors while remaining structurally exceptional, providing versatility in style to fit any home.

  6. Environmental Friendliness:Many manufacturers utilize recycled products in the building of composite doors. This makes them a more sustainable alternative compared to standard wooden doors, which contribute to logging.

Aspects to Consider When Choosing Composite Doors

Before investing in composite doors, it's important to consider numerous elements that influence their effectiveness, appearance, and expense:

  1. Quality and Certification:Look for doors that have actually been accredited by acknowledged companies for quality and safety requirements. This makes sure that you're purchasing a product that meets market standards for sturdiness and security.

  2. Style and Design:Consider the architectural design of your home before choosing a design. Composite doors can be found in numerous designs, consisting of contemporary, standard, and even bespoke choices tailored to your specifications.

  3. Energy Ratings:Like devices, doors likewise come with energy scores. Look for the energy effectiveness score label to guarantee you are making a sensible financial investment that contributes to decrease energy costs.

  4. Installation:Proper setup is important to the performance of your composite door. It is extremely advised to use professional installers to guarantee that the door fits completely and operates efficiently.

  5. Warranty:Most composite door makers provide guarantees, ensuring that your investment is protected. Make sure to check out the fine print and understand what is covered under the guarantee.

  6. Expense:Composite doors normally range from mid to high price points. While door repair service may be more expensive than standard wood doors, the long-lasting cost savings in maintenance and energy effectiveness can offset this initial cost.
